Don Quixote was written by Miguel de Cervantes. True or false
Answer : True.
Explanation : "Don Quixote de la Mancha" is a novel written by the Spanish Miguel de Cervantes Saavedra at the beginning of the year 1605. It was published in English in the year 1612.
